The Opportunity
KBR is driving a Digital Engineering strategy to manage complexity, harness our technical capability, and deliver speed to capability for Defence. This strategy enables advanced digital environments and facilities to support Defence programs, including the development, hosting, and integration of systems as models, architectures, and digital twins.
As a Systems Architect, you will play a pivotal role in both execution and enablement. You’ll work with domain specialists and stakeholders to capture and model concepts, requirements, and designs for major Defence programs such as C4ISREW, MILSATCOM, Space and other critical capabilities. Responsibilities include developing and sustaining MBSE architectures using tools like CATIA Cameo, Enterprise Architect, or ANSYS, undertaking mission engineering through mission threads and scenarios, and applying modelling and simulation across the lifecycle to ensure traceability from requirements through to verification.
You will also help grow KBR’s Digital Engineering Infrastructure, including the Systems Integration Laboratory and collaborative virtual network environments. This involves engaging with clients and stakeholders to mature facilities and capability. Strong technical knowledge of Defence platforms, applications, and systems will be highly valued, alongside an understanding of emerging technologies such as AI/ML, digital twins, and cloud platforms.
This role requires collaboration, innovation, and technical leadership to drive growth and capability across KBR’s Australian Defence and Security Solutions business.
Responsibilities
The key responsibilities of the role will include, but are not limited to:
Develop and integrate Mission Engineering Models and Simulations using Model-based Systems Engineering (MBSE) digital modelling and simulation tools in execution of the KBR Digital Engineering Strategy. These activities will be undertaken both during the capture and execution phases.
Define End to End Architecture solutions aligned to technology standards and roadmaps and strategies in response to business requirements.
Grow capability enablement maturity through collaboration with the team of the KBR Digital Engineering Project. This may involve input to design of environments, development of models, guidance or reports.
Analyse and evaluate and if necessary, validate externally sourced models and integrated them into the System or Enterprise framework.
Enhance KBR Digital Engineering Knowledge Base for execution through delivery of model or environment artefacts, configuration scripts and enhancements to support reuse or adoption.
Undertake stakeholder engagement and collaboration with defence clients, project teams, and industry partners to define system architecture strategies and technical roadmaps.
Manage the configuration and databases appropriate for the digital engineering toolchains, including Requirements Management, Windchill PLM, MBSE, simulation, and data analytics platforms.
Ensure architectural solutions comply with appropriate defence standards (e.g., ASDEFCON, MIL-STD-881, ISO/IEC 15288) and cybersecurity protocols.
Gather and evaluate user feedback and recommend and execute improvements to models and support changes to environments.
Analyse interfaces and integrate supplier and customer models into overall system or enterprise frameworks.
Create technical documentation and deliver reporting on the status and capability of the modelling activity.
Support the enhancement and deployment of Digital Engineering environment, including infrastructure, applications and services.
